Make sure that the peak sections of the waveform don’t appear yellow, which indicates distortion, or red, which indicates clipping (severe distortion). Change audio volume in iMovie on Mac As you adjust the volume of a clip in iMovie, its audio waveform changes shape and color to reflect your adjustments.
